Scientists say they have figured out how an experimental drug called ketamine is able to relieve major depression in hours instead of weeks.
Ketamine, the veterinary anesthetic turned party drug, has previously been shown to rapidly and radically reduce symptoms of depression in some people. However, until now, scientists have been uncertain about how it actually does this.
